Celtic won 3-2 over Rangers on Saturday as Ange Postecoglou and his players moved 12 points clear at the top of the Scottish Premiership.

Kyogo and Jota were on the scoresheet for the Hoops in the victory and as well as being able to see their goals from a unique angle, in the derby episode of Matchday Paradise on Celtic’s YouTube channel, we got a unique insight into part of Celtic’s pre match buildup.

The Hoops part take in numerous drills on the pitch before kick off and in one particular instance where the Bhoys were stretching, we were able to hear captain Callum McGregor dishing out hugely encouraging motivation and advice to his teammates:

“We understand the pressure, we understand the game, we stay calm, you’ve got to be able to be clear, understand the pressures, understand when the press is coming.

“As soon as we beat that press, we accelerate the attack.”

We know that Celtic, especially under Ange, will constantly look to play out from the back and surpass any press from the opposition.

The Hoops themselves also look to coax their opponents into mistakes and this was certainly the case at the weekend as a few Gers errors led to Hoops goals.

Nevertheless, what we heard from Callum McGregor was greatly intriguing. He is undoubtedly a tremendous role model as a captain and someone every player in the Celtic dressing room will look up to.

This short clip is just a snippet of how McGregor leads and sets the standards for his teammates yet it is hugely fascinating for fans and gives a rare insight into what is said between the players prior to a colossal match such as Saturday’s.
